Loggerhead Kingbird

Cuba

The Loggerhead Kingbird is a bigger, meaner looking version of the Eastern Kingbird, at least that’s how it looks to me. They were pretty much everywhere in Cuba that we visited but this was the first one I saw during our visit. It’s funny because I really had to search to find one in Puerto Rico when I saw this species for the first time so I guess I had an expectation that the situation would be similar in Cuba. When this bird appeared, I was working on getting a photo of a Cuban Green Woodpecker and I allowed the kingbird to distract me from what was, as I recall, the only Cuban Green Woodpecker I saw on the trip. If only I knew then what I know now.
